Abstract

In 2022, 145 poets, practitioners, and scholars from 14 countries around the globe gathered in Cape Town for the eighth installation of the International Symposium on Poetic Inquiry – the very first time on African soil since its inception in 2007. The Human Sciences Research Council and the African Sun Press published “Voices Unbound”, an anthology of poems from the symposium.
